Answer a Call Waiting
The 5324 IP Phone allows a maximum of three calls waiting while you are on a call. The
5312 IP Phone allows one call waiting. New calls wait on the next free line. When a new call
arrives, you hear a call waiting tone, the name of the new caller appears, and the
corresponding Line key flashes. If all lines are busy, callers hear a busy signal.
To answer a waiting call:
Press the flashing Line key of the call waiting. The current call is put on hold, and you are
connected to the new caller.
To return to the original call:
Press the associated flashing Line key.
Calling and Called Party Display
SIP phones display the true (programmed) identity of the called/calling party rather than the
standard number/name display.
